SHIPPING REPORTS. The British steamer Measuir, from Manila 19th October, lind moderate to fresh winds and 60s, and Brie and cloudy weather.
The Britisk steuner Kefony, from Cebu 18th October, led light to moderate variable winds to 250 miles of Hongkong; thence to port fresh N.E. monsoon and high N.N.E. swell.
The Apierican steamer Chiyuen, from Shang- hai 19th October, had light to moderate northerly breezes and hue weather to Tung Yung. From thence wind freshened to fresh northerly gale with high sou in Formosa Channel; off the Brothers wind moderated; moderate to light breezes to port.
